515492
0000000000000000000e506cd875fa8c2b171ddc8e5d7b0e78a664c9b2fc6ed9
Time
03-28-2018 12:11:29 (Local)
Sponsored
Transaction Fees
0.00445565
BTC
Confirmations
411899
Total Amounts
296287.68923109 USDT
Transaction Counts
39
Previous Block:
Merkle Root:
c1543f07555e586ce56c68e1c80ce0a24a1b9740a3ca07aaefd7001d66a9b8c7
APIs